Record-breaking emission allowance prices in the third quarter of 2019

From the beginning of the year to the end of September 2019, the revenues from trade with CO2 emission allowances for Bulgaria are 332 million EUR (649 million BGN) or with 33% more compared to the same period last year according to European Energy Exchange (EEX) data. In the third quarter of 2019, revenues were highest in July 2019, reaching 54.5 million EUR. The increasing of the emission revenues is mainly due to the higher prices for the nine months of 2019 compared to the same period of the 2018. According to Art. 10 (3) of the Directive establishing a scheme for greenhouse gas emission allowance trading Member States determine how the proceeds of the auctioning of allowances will be used. It is imperative that at least 50% of the revenue from allowances be used in activities related to greenhouse gas emission reductions, RES development, and the development of other technologies contributing to the transition to a safe and sustainable low carbon economy, to support compliance with the commitment to increase energy efficiency by 20% by 2020, measures to prevent deforestation and increase afforestation, environmentally friendly capture and storage of CO2 in geological formations, promote the transition to you s low-emission transport and public transport, finance research and development activities related to energy efficiency and clean technologies. On October 23, 2019, the Council of Ministers approved a bill to supplement the Climate Change Restriction Act. It establishes a harmonized legal framework to put in place a mechanism to support businesses in the industrial sectors and sub-sectors at significant risk of carbon leakage due to indirect costs of greenhouse gas emissions at final electricity price. The State aid scheme will be implemented through the issuing of an ordinance by the Minister of Economy and will be implemented after its notification by the European Commission. Up to 25% of the revenue generated from the auctioning of greenhouse gas emissions allowances will be used for this purpose. According to the price decision Ц-19 / 1.07.2019 the energy regulator estimates the revenues from the sale of emission allowances to reach 861 mln. leva (440 million euros) for the period 1.07.2019-30.06.2020.
